The Old Testament and God's Promises

In the Old Testament, we encounter numerous instances where God extends His promises to His people. From the covenant with Abraham to the promise of the Promised Land and the establishment of God's covenant with David, these promises are woven into the fabric of ancient history.

God's Promises to Abraham

One of the most significant promises in the Old Testament is God's covenant with Abraham. In Genesis 12:2-3, God promises to bless Abraham and make him a great nation. This promise is not limited to Abraham alone; it extends to all his descendants and ultimately finds its fulfillment in the coming of Jesus Christ.

The Promise of the Promised Land

Another prominent promise in the Old Testament is the covenant between God and the Israelites regarding the Promised Land. Despite their struggles and wanderings in the wilderness, God assures them of a land flowing with milk and honey. This promise is a testament to God's faithfulness and His commitment to provide for His people.

God's Covenant with David

In 2 Samuel 7:12-13, God makes a covenant with David, promising that one of his descendants will rule on the throne forever. This promise looks forward to the coming of Jesus Christ, who fulfills this role as the eternal King of kings. God's promise to David highlights His sovereign plan and His desire to establish an everlasting kingdom.

The New Testament and God's Promises

With the arrival of Jesus Christ, the promised Messiah, a new era begins, heralding a fresh revelation of God's promises.

The Promise of Salvation through Jesus Christ

The ultimate promise of the New Testament is the offer of salvation through Jesus Christ. In John 3:16, we read that God so loved the world that He gave His only Son, that whoever believes in Him shall not perish but have eternal life. This promise assures us of forgiveness, redemption, and eternal fellowship with God.

The Promise of the Holy Spirit

In Acts 2:38, Jesus promises His disciples the gift of the Holy Spirit. This promise becomes a reality on the day of Pentecost, empowering believers to live out their faith and bringing comfort, guidance, and spiritual transformation. The presence of the Holy Spirit assures us of God's constant companionship and guidance on our journey.

The Promise of Eternal Life

Revelation 21:4 speaks of a promise that is yet to be fully realized – the promise of eternal life in the new heaven and earth. This grand culmination of God's promises offers us a glimpse of the future glory that awaits those who trust in Him. It reminds us that our present sufferings are temporary, and an everlasting bliss awaits us in eternity.
